I had been diagnosed with moderate osteoarthritis in my right hip in the fall of 2009. My general practitioner indicated exercise and pain killers. I started walking 6 klm every morning, whether hot and sunny, or bitterly cold. By April of 2010 the arthritis in my hip had become severe. After a year of walking, diligently to stay strong, my journeys were put on hold.
Osteoarthritis is another way of saying that the cartilage in my hip, that which separates the major load bearing bones, was wearing thin. Once severe it was bone on bone and quite painful. Meanwhile my wife and I had moved from the Greater Toronto Area to Niagara Falls, Ontario. With many boxes still looking to be emptied my surgery was scheduled for September 1st, 2010.
Hip surgery is somewhat invasive, to say the least, and after five days in the hospital I was released on my own recognizance... not quite, I had lots of help. Weeks of physio-therapy later and I was able to re-start my early morning 6 klm walks. However, that only lasted so long. I eventually had to stop because my left knee was giving me problems. Something was causing pain, so back to my trusted specialist to see what was wrong. Sure enough, this time it was a torn, or as he put it, shredded, meniscus. That's the curved cartilage that separates the major bones meeting in the knee.
My next surgery, not so invasive this time, will be this Thursday, October 27th, 2011. It would appear that an imbalance caused by a disruption on one side of my body, confused the other side of my body, or as some would say, "these problems come in pairs". I have full confidence in my surgeon, he's great and the hospital staff is quite wary of him because he is so meticulous. I have no worries, but the anesthetic injected into my spine is no joy.

A bug by any other name
There will be more of these unfortunately, but it's all part of life. The new super-bug, or bacterial infection, is called Community-Acquired Methicillin-Resistant Staphylococcus Aureus, or CA-MRSA for short.
It is a bacteria that has mutated over the years to now be even more resistant to anti-biotics than it once was. If you've read any of my earlier articles you may recall that I was once afflicted with the flesh-eating disease. And the CA-MRSA can develop into that if not treated soon enough.
CA-MRSA is not an epidemic but outbreaks have occurred in more and more communities where people might share towels, locker rooms and the like. Originally, found mostly in hospitals, the infection often appears as a growing boil on the extremeties. Basic personal hygiene is your best defense. It it transmitted by touch.
In the big picture, this is not to alarm anyone. It is to keep reminding you that the smallest of enemies may be the most powerful. And they are getting stronger day by day.

What a gas
Everyone has some bacteria swimming around in the back of their mouths. And sometimes a sore throat can turn into a not so minor strep throat. That can be treated easily.
That is if the bacteria are well behaved. If the little gremlins get loose, look out! Such was my turning point in July of 1994. The day after working several hours in the backyard I forced myself to go to a local clinic, feeling quite dizzy. After a blood test and Tylenol, the doctor dismissed me suggesting I might have Mononucleosis. That evening, my son roused me from a nap only to discover that my mords were wixed, and I was white and clammy. We then discovered I could no longer walk.
Once in emergency and after being seen by two doctors, I blacked out. Apparently, a visiting doctor then took an interest and, after seeing an ominous rash on my back, called the CDC in Atlanta. The diagnosis... Necrotizing Fasciitis, sometimes called Group A Strep Toxic Shock Syndrome, or the Flesh Eating Disease!
In 1994, at least, I learned that only 1 in 7 physicians are able to diagnose the disease. Moreover, it's very often fatal, not so much because the bacteria kills you outright, but because of the treatment. Many will succumb to the effects of massive doses of anti-biotics, long before any surgery can ever take place.
I was lucky in that my heart was strong, so they say. Also I came out of the hospital two weeks later intact... no amputations. Not everyone is so lucky.
We cannot control the behaviour of bacteria that runs rampant, but we can do things to prevent our immune systems from being compromised, which makes us susceptible to such rare infections.
In the grand scheme of things, did this technology contribute to me having a better life? or just a longer one?
